zephyr/dts/bindings
Gerard Marull-Paretas e671d363b8 drivers: memc: stm32: initial support for stm32 FMC
This commit adds a new driver category for memory controller
peripherals. There is no API involved for now, as it has not been found
necessary for first implementation.

STM32 Flexible Memory Controller (FMC) is the only controller supported
for now. This peripheral allows to access multiple types of external
memories, e.g. SDRAM, NAND, NOR Flash...

The initial implementation adds support for the SDRAM controller only.
The HAL API is used, so the implementation should be portable to other
STM32 series. It has only been tested on H7 series, so for now it can
only be enabled when working on H7.

Linker facilities have also been added in order to allow applications to
easily define a variable in SDRAM.

Signed-off-by: Gerard Marull-Paretas <gerard@teslabs.com>
2020-11-24 16:33:17 +01:00
..
adc adc-mcux: add support for adc16 channel multiplex 2020-10-29 13:43:24 -05:00
arc
arm boards: arm: nordic: Update DTS for nrf21540 2020-11-19 17:02:00 -05:00
audio
base devicetree: add properties for power supply control 2020-10-28 15:22:53 +01:00
bluetooth
can
clock
cpu
crypto
dac
display drivers: display: ili9xxx: add support for ILI9488 controller 2020-11-10 15:52:12 -06:00
dma dts: dma : stm32 soc with dmamux has a special offset 2020-11-19 17:04:25 -05:00
ec_host_cmd_perhip
espi
ethernet drivers: ethernet: stm32: add support for DT pinctrl 2020-10-30 15:54:13 +01:00
flash_controller dts: bindings: Fix some YAML issues 2020-10-23 08:02:19 -05:00
gpio dts: bindings: Fix some YAML issues 2020-10-23 08:02:19 -05:00
hwinfo
i2c dts: i2c: Add atmel sam TWIM controllers 2020-11-19 10:52:49 -06:00
i2s dts/bindings/i2s: stm32: Add pinctrl-0 property 2020-10-28 09:29:56 -05:00
ieee802154
iio/adc
interrupt-controller dts/bindings: Add binding for riscv,clint0 2020-11-19 17:00:46 -05:00
ipm
kscan
led
led_strip
lora
memory-controllers drivers: memc: stm32: initial support for stm32 FMC 2020-11-24 16:33:17 +01:00
mhu
misc
mmc dts/bindings/mmc: stm32: Add pinctrl-0 support 2020-10-29 09:21:27 +01:00
mmu_mpu
modem
mtd
pcie/endpoint
peci
phy
pinctrl
power
ps2
pwm dts: bindings: add bindings for the Xilinx AXI Timer 2020-11-17 19:30:20 -05:00
regulator drivers: regulator: add GPIO-controlled regulator driver 2020-10-28 15:22:53 +01:00
riscv
rng
rtc dts: bindings: add bindings for the Xilinx AXI Timer 2020-11-17 19:30:20 -05:00
sensor drivers: sensor: Convert fxos8700 vector mag Kconfigs to dts properties 2020-11-17 16:51:50 -05:00
serial serial: Add support for GRLIB APBUART 2020-11-13 14:53:55 -08:00
spi devicetree: add properties for power supply control 2020-10-28 15:22:53 +01:00
sram
tach
test dts: bindings: test: Update vnd,serial to not require interrupts 2020-10-23 08:53:38 -05:00
timer timer: Add support for GRLIB GPTIMER 2020-11-13 14:53:55 -08:00
usb
video
watchdog
wifi drivers: wifi: eswifi: Add uart bus interface 2020-11-03 11:05:43 +01:00
vendor-prefixes.txt soc: LEON3 SPARC V8 Processor 2020-11-13 14:53:55 -08:00